下载好JDK后放入/usr目录下,在该目录下mkdir(新建)一个java文件夹,用命令chmod 777 jdk7u79linuxx64.tar.gz修改文件权限,命令行输入tar -xzvf jdk7u79linuxx64.tar.gz 进行解压。将解压后的文件mv到java文件夹下。然后就是最重要的设置Java环境变量了。
设置环境变量步骤:
1.vi打开文件命令:vi /etc/profile
2.将光标移至文件末尾回车插入一个空行,键盘按字母i进入编辑模式
3.输入以下信息:
JAVA_HOME=/usr/java/jdk1.7.0_79
PATH=$JAVA_HOME/bin:$PATH
CLASSPATH=.:$JAVA_HOME/lib/dt.jar:$JAVA_HOME/lib/tools.jar
export JAVA_HOME
export PATH
export CLASSPATH
4.按Esc退出编辑模式,输入: wq!(:也要输入)保存并退出。
至此,JDK环境配置完毕。
有些Linux系统,比如Centos,默认会安装OpenOffice之类的软件,这些软件需要Java的支持,默认会安装JDK的环境,若需要特定的Java环境,最好将默认的JDK彻底删除。
卸载系统自带jdk:
1.终端输入,查看gcj的版本号:rpm -qa|grep jdk
得到结果:(以下的jdk版本会因不同的系统而不一样,我这里以我机器上的为例)
jdk-1.7.0_04-fcs.x86_64
java-1.6.0-openjdk-1.6.0.0-1.49.1.11.4.el6_3.x86_64
2. 终端输入,卸载:yum -y remove java java-1.6.0-openjdk-1.6.0.0-1.49.1.11.4.el6_3.x86_64,等待系统自动卸载,最终终端显示 Complete,卸载完成。
做完这些步骤之后,在终端输入命令:source /etc/profile。让系统配置立即生效,不用重启系统。
注意:如果出现以下错误信息
bash: /usr/java/jdk1.7.0_04/lib/dt.jar:
bash: /usr/java/jdk1.7.0_04/lib/tools.jar:
那么说明权限不够,切换到root再试试。
最后,可以输入java -version 查看java版本是否是我们设置的jdk1.7.0_79。